Chemical Discription: Anthraquinone
Shade: Redder Blue
Light Fastness: 6
Chemical Class: Acid
Form: Powder
Used for dyeing leather, wool, silk, Nylon, Paper & importantly as Bluring agent to improve whiteness of bleached fabrics. Used for dyeing of leather, paper & also as bluing agent (fabric whitener). Specially treated to reduce the chrome levels as required for specific customers in international markets. These are specially purified dyes to remove all impurities such as chlorides. Sulphates & other by products. The purity achieved is almost 99.5% (On dry basis).
Advantages :
Due to high purity, very high solubility & very low free chlorides & sulfates these dyes are ideally suited for aqueous inks such as jet inks, ball pen inks, sketch pen inks & leather dyeing.

Acid Violet 17 Salt Free Grade
Description | Saltfree grade |
---|---|
Strength | >400% |
Insoluble | < 0.2% |
Solubility | >160 gms/ l |
pH of 1% soln. | 07/08/09 |
Free chloride | < 200 ppm |
Free sulphate | < 200 ppm |
Moisture | < 3% |
Chrome content | <50 ppm |
